网思科技/云徙科技前端实习面经

投票
网思科技:(面试官应该是照着稿子问的)
1.css中的块级元素、行内元素、行内块元素的区别
2.css中隐藏元素的方式
3.什么是盒模型
4.js的基本数据类型
5.localstorage、sessionstorage、cookie的区别
6.声明变量的方式
7.是如何调试的
8.vue的内置指令有哪些
9.浅拷贝和深拷贝有什么区别,实现方式
10.vue中组件通信方式有哪些
11.vue和react他们都有什么优势(因为我说我更熟悉react)
12.vue的打包工具有哪些
13.webpack和vite之间有什么区别
14.了解过node.js吗
15.说说你最熟悉的项目,你完成了哪些模块的开发,出现问题是怎样解决的
16,说一下vue生命周期有哪些阶段,各自有什么作用
云徙科技(面试小哥态度很好,体验很不错,回答不出来的都说了没事,我懂你意思,后面用的时候查,你让我也记不住全部)
1.看你写了axios封装,你认为在axios中能做哪些操作,怎么让请求停止
2.强缓存和协商缓存的区别(我在上一个问题中说了缓存)
3.在react中如何捕获错误
4.tcp三次握手的过程
5.react中setstate的第二个参数是啥
6.在react当状态更新后,怎样获取新的状态
7.useeffect的第二个参数是啥,有啥作用
反问:主要业务方向,主要技术栈
有转正的机会不
#前端##前端实习##面试##秋招找不到##12月份实习##牛客创作赏金赛#
全部评论

相关推荐

当涉及前端代码的部署流程时,通常有几个关键步骤需要遵循:https://www.nowcoder.com/issue/tutorial?zhuanlanId=Mg58Em&uuid=07d53be4cd034a4ab270d500feebcc8d代码开发:前端开发人员使用各种技术和工具(如HTML、CSS、JavaScript)创建网站或应用程序的用户界面。他们编写代码并进行调试以确保其功能正常。版本控制:采用版本控制工具(如Git)管理前端代码的版本。这有助于团队成员之间协同工作、追踪更改和恢复到以前的版本。构建:在将代码部署到生产环境之前,通常需要进行构建。这涉及将多个源代码文件合并、压缩和优化,以提高性能并减少加载时间。构建过程可以使用工具如Webpack、Grunt或Gulp来完成。测试:在部署前,进行测试是至关重要的。测试可以包括单元测试、集成测试和端到端测试,以确保代码在各种浏览器和设备上的适配性和可靠性。部署:完成构建和测试后,将代码部署到服务器或托管平台上。这可以通过FTP上传文件,使用命令行工具(如SSH)远程连接服务器或使用自动化部署工具(如Jenkins、Travis CI)来完成。监控和维护:一旦部署完成,需要监控前端应用程序的性能和可用性。这可以使用工具如Google Analytics、New Relic等来实现。同时,如果需要进行更新或修复,可以重复前述步骤。以上是一个基本的前端代码部署流程。具体的步骤和工具可能因团队的需求和工作流程而有所不同。
点赞 评论 收藏
分享
一眨眼又到周一了。上周六,部门里好多人都去加班了,我没有去。原本想着,这周去了,应该又要被项目助理谈话了。我已经做好了心理准备,在这一次谈话时,向项目助理表明:您裁掉我吧,我不会主动申请离职的。结果上午十点左右,同一个屋子里的另一个项目的项目负责人,将我叫过去说:你现在是我们这个组的了,等会让XXX给你分个活。不知道是不是因为经历了裁员谈话,我现在变得太敏感了。在他说话的时候,我能感觉到他根本就不太想要我,只是因为领导和他说了,所以勉为其难的让我加入到他的项目组。同样的,我也不想在这最后的时间里,加入到一个新的项目组了。经过了两天的冷静,我计划是被裁了之后,找个机会告诉父母。然后用这四个月攒的钱摆烂两个月,年后回到省内找一份新的工作。经历了之前的裁员谈话,我才意识到:原来我在领导眼里,只是个拖大家后腿的角色。并且我也反思了一下,或许真的是因为刚出校门,自己还不够成熟,没有意识到资本的残酷,只想着安稳的在这里一直干下去。或许,不断的被裁、不停的奔波,才是人生的常态。真是当断不断,必受其乱。早知道这样,当时在项目助理说完“你立刻回到部门主动申请离职”后,我就应该主动对她说:您将我裁掉吧。现在领导似乎给了我一次机会,可我已经无法在这样一个充满贬低的环境中,继续心无杂念的去工作了。在经历了这次的裁员谈话之后,我内心强大了很多。我相信,下一份工作,我应该能做的更好。
点赞 评论 收藏
分享
评论
1
3
分享
牛客网
牛客企业服务